The hexadecimal color code #A6E368 corresponds to the code RGB( 166, 227, 104 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,65 level), green (at 0,89 level) and blue (at 0,41 level). Its brightness is 64% and its saturation is 68%. It is composed of red at 33%, green at 45% and blue at 20%.
